Pakistan would carefully examine the Bonn declaration, says Pakistani Foreign Minister

Pakistani Foreign Minister, Hina Rabbani Khar, has assured her German counterpart that Pakistan would carefully examine the Bonn declaration. German Foreign Minister, Dr. Guido Westerwelle, reportedly called Khar to take Pakistan into confidence on the outcome of the Bonn Conference on Afghanistan on Tuesday, December 6. Capital abuzz with rumours over the president’s health

Islamabad was once again abuzz with rumours on Wednesday that President Asif Ali Zardari was resigning due to health issues. The announcement on Monday that the president had suddenly left for Dubai for medical check-up has already led to speculative news that he might resign from his office.
